The is a specialized driver primarily used for connecting mobile devices powered by RDA/Coolsand chipsets (often found in "feature phones") to a Windows PC for flashing, IMEI repair, or data transfer . The Gallite 8809 architecture pre-dates USB 3.0. Connecting the device to a blue USB 3.0 or USB-C port can cause timing errors. Use a legacy black USB 2.0 port if available.

: On Windows 10 or 11, you may need to disable Driver Signature Enforcement to install older, unsigned drivers.

Because these drivers are often unsigned or legacy drivers, they typically require a manual installation through the Windows Device Manager. Follow these steps carefully to ensure a successful setup.
